Fusidic acid binding to serum albumin and interaction with binding of bilirubin.

Csak regisztrált felhasználók fordíthatnak cikkeket
Belépés Regisztrálás
Sodium fusidate, an antibiotic used in staphylococcal infections, is strongly bound to human serum albumin, competitively with bilirubin. Methicillin res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) may be found on the skin, nose, and throats of long-term hospitalized patients. While MRSA infections are usually minor, serious infections and death may occur in immunocompromised or diabetic patients, or after exposure of MRSA to blood.
